Brody meaning and etymology

The name "Brody" is of Scottish origin and is believed to have derived from the Gaelic surname "Ó Bruadair," meaning "descendant of Bruadar." The name Bruadar itself has roots in the Gaelic word "bruadair," which translates to "dream" or "vision." This etymology suggests a connection to the concept of dreaming or having visionary qualities. Therefore, the name "Brody" may carry connotations of insight, intuition, or imaginative thinking.

Pronounciation

The name "Brody" is pronounced as BRO-dee. The emphasis is on the first syllable, and the "o" is pronounced as a short vowel sound. Regional pronunciation variants may include slight differences in vowel emphasis or intonation.

Gender usage

The name "Brody" is predominantly associated with boys, although it has also been used for girls in some instances. It exhibits a strong masculine association, but its usage has shown trends toward unisex appeal in contemporary naming practices.

Trends

In the United States, the name "Brody" has gained popularity in recent years. It ranked in the top 100 names for boys in the US for the year 2020, indicating a notable frequency of use. The name has seen a consistent upward trend in usage, appealing to a diverse demographic range.

Geographical distribution

The name "Brody" is prevalent in English-speaking regions, with notable usage in the United States, Canada, and Australia. Its variations may be found in regions with historical ties to Gaelic heritage.
